Output 53e0274c766087979bee28a821fefde4c900049108fc096f74a0b1a2bf58bda0:18

value
265841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04423dd25782e748dc0ee57b2c6a8f77df55966e OP_EQUAL
address
325XyrHVCVtjvAjSJvyd65hrbZnyZqjago
transaction
53e0274c766087979bee28a821fefde4c900049108fc096f74a0b1a2bf58bda0